Smoke Bomb
A smoke bomb is a firework designed to produce a large amount of smoke upon ignition. History Early Japanese history saw the use of a rudimentary form of the smoke bomb. Explosives were common in Japan during the Mongol invasions of the 13th century. Soft cased hand-held bombs were later designed to release smoke, poison gas, and shrapnel made from iron and pottery. The modern smoke bomb was created in 1848, by the British inventor Robert Yale. He developed 17th-century Chinese-style fireworks and later modified the formula to produce more smoke for a longer period. Colored smoke devices use a formula that consists of an oxidizer (typically potassium nitrate, KNO3), a fuel (generally sugar), a moderator (such as sodium bicarbonate) to keep the reaction from getting too hot, and a powdered organic dye. Pyrotechnics Training DVIDS1092555
Pyrotechnics is the science and craft of creating fireworks, but also includes safety matches, oxygen candles, Pyrotechnic fastener, explosive bolts (and other fasteners), parts of automotive airbags, as well as gas-pressure blasting in mining, quarrying, and demolition. This trade relies upon self-contained and self-sustained exothermic chemical reactions to make heat, light, gas, smoke and/or sound. The name etymology, comes from the Greek words ''pyr'' (πυρ; 'fire') and ''technikós'' (τεχνικός; 'artistic'). Improper use of pyrotechnics could lead to List of pyrotechnic incidents, pyrotechnic accidents. People responsible for the safe storage, handling, and functioning of pyrotechnic devices are known as pyrotechnicians. Proximate pyrotechnics Explosions, flashes, smoke, flames, fireworks and other pyrotechnic-driven effects used in the entertainment industry are referred to as proximate pyrotechnics. Colored Smoke
Colored smoke is a kind of smoke created by an particulate, aerosol of small particles of a suitable pigment or dye. Colored smoke can be used for smoke signals, often in a military context. It can be produced by smoke grenades, or by various other pyrotechnical devices. The mixture used for producing colored smoke is usually a cooler-burning formula based on potassium chlorate oxidizer, lactose or dextrin as a fuel, and one or more dyes, with about 40-50% content of the dye. About 2% sodium bicarbonate may be added as a coolant, to lower the burning temperature. Coloured smoke was first used in 1967 during an American burnout (vehicle), burnout competition by a small contestant, as a means to wow the crowd. Smoke released from aircraft was originally based on a mixture of 10-15% dye, 60-65% trichloroethylene or tetrachloroethylene, and 25% diesel oil, injected into the exhaust gases of the aircraft engines. Combustion
Combustion, or burning, is a high-temperature exothermic redox chemical reaction between a fuel (the reductant) and an oxidant, usually atmospheric oxygen, that produces oxidized, often gaseous products, in a mixture termed as smoke. Combustion does not always result in fire, because a flame is only visible when substances undergoing combustion vaporize, but when it does, a flame is a characteristic indicator of the reaction. While activation energy must be supplied to initiate combustion (e.g., using a lit match to light a fire), the heat from a flame may provide enough energy to make the reaction self-sustaining. The study of combustion is known as combustion science. Combustion is often a complicated sequence of elementary reaction, elementary Radical (chemistry), radical reactions. Solid fuels, such as wood and coal, first undergo endothermic pyrolysis to produce gaseous fuels whose combustion then supplies the heat required to produce more of them. Boiling
Boiling or ebullition is the rapid phase transition from liquid to gas or vapor, vapour; the reverse of boiling is condensation. Boiling occurs when a liquid is heated to its boiling point, so that the vapour pressure of the liquid is equal to the pressure exerted on the liquid by the Standard atmosphere (unit), surrounding atmosphere. Boiling and evaporation are the two main forms of liquid vapourization. There are two main types of boiling: nucleate boiling, where small bubbles of vapour form at discrete points; and critical heat flux boiling, where the boiling surface is heated above a certain critical temperature and a film of vapour forms on the surface. Transition boiling is an intermediate, unstable form of boiling with elements of both types. The boiling point of water is 100 °C or 212 °F but is lower with the decreased atmospheric pressure found at higher altitudes. Sodium Bicarbonate
Sodium bicarbonate ( IUPAC name: sodium hydrogencarbonate), commonly known as baking soda or bicarbonate of soda (or simply “bicarb” especially in the UK) is a chemical compound with the formula NaHCO3. It is a salt composed of a sodium cation ( Na+) and a bicarbonate anion (). Sodium bicarbonate is a white solid that is crystalline but often appears as a fine powder. It has a slightly salty, alkaline taste resembling that of washing soda ( sodium carbonate). The natural mineral form is nahcolite, although it is more commonly found as a component of the mineral trona. As it has long been known and widely used, the salt has many different names such as baking soda, bread soda, cooking soda, brewing soda and bicarbonate of soda and can often be found near baking powder in stores. The term ''baking soda'' is more common in the United States, while ''bicarbonate of soda'' is more common in Australia, the United Kingdom, and New Zealand. Sugar
Sugar is the generic name for sweet-tasting, soluble carbohydrates, many of which are used in food. Compound sugars, also called disaccharides or double sugars, are molecules made of two bonded monosaccharides; common examples are sucrose (glucose + fructose), lactose (glucose + galactose), and maltose (two molecules of glucose). White sugar is almost pure sucrose. In the body, compound sugars are hydrolysed into simple sugars. Longer chains of monosaccharides (>2) are not regarded as sugars and are called oligosaccharides or polysaccharides. Potassium Nitrate
Potassium nitrate is a chemical compound with a sharp, salty, bitter taste and the chemical formula . It is a potassium salt of nitric acid. This salt consists of potassium cations and nitrate anions , and is therefore an alkali metal nitrate. It occurs in nature as a mineral, niter (or ''nitre'' outside the United States). It is a source of nitrogen, and nitrogen was named after niter. Potassium nitrate is one of several nitrogen-containing compounds collectively referred to as saltpetre (or saltpeter in the United States). Major uses of potassium nitrate are in fertilizers, tree stump removal, rocket propellants and fireworks. It is one of the major constituents of traditional gunpowder (black powder). In processed meats, potassium nitrate reacts with hemoglobin and myoglobin generating a red color. Oxidizer
An oxidizing agent (also known as an oxidant, oxidizer, electron recipient, or electron acceptor) is a substance in a redox chemical reaction that gains or " accepts"/"receives" an electron from a (called the , , or ''electron donor''). In other words, an oxidizer is any substance that oxidizes another substance. The oxidation state, which describes the degree of loss of electrons, of the oxidizer decreases while that of the reductant increases; this is expressed by saying that oxidizers "undergo reduction" and "are reduced" while reducers "undergo oxidation" and "are oxidized". Common oxidizing agents are oxygen, hydrogen peroxide, and the halogens. In one sense, an oxidizing agent is a chemical species that undergoes a chemical reaction in which it gains one or more electrons. In that sense, it is one component in an oxidation–reduction (redox) reaction. Pottery
Pottery is the process and the products of forming vessels and other objects with clay and other raw materials, which are fired at high temperatures to give them a hard and durable form. The place where such wares are made by a ''potter'' is also called a ''pottery'' (plural ''potteries''). The definition of ''pottery'', used by the ASTM International, is "all fired ceramic wares that contain clay when formed, except technical, structural, and refractory products". End applications include tableware, ceramic art, decorative ware, toilet, sanitary ware, and in technology and industry such as Insulator (electricity), electrical insulators and laboratory ware. In art history and archaeology, especially of ancient and prehistoric periods, pottery often means only vessels, and sculpture, sculpted figurines of the same material are called terracottas.
